Metal detecting is a fun and exciting hobby that requires knowledge of various aspects such as the technology behind it. One of these important things to consider is coil frequency, which refers to the number of times per second that the search coil sends and receives signals.
The frequency used in metal detectors can vary from 3 kHz to over 100 kHz. Low-frequency machines are great for detecting large objects at greater depths, while high-frequency machines are best for finding small or shallow targets. The ideal frequency depends on what you’re looking for.
For instance, if you want to find coins or jewelry buried just below the surface, then a higher-frequency machine would be best suited for your needs. With frequencies ranging between 14kHz and 75kHz, these devices offer excellent sensitivity and can pick up very small targets with ease.
On the other hand, if you’re searching for relics or artifacts buried deep underground, then a lower-frequency detector may be more appropriate. These machines typically operate at frequencies below 10kHz and can detect larger objects at greater depths than their high-frequency counterparts.
It’s worth noting that some modern metal detectors come equipped with multiple frequency settings that allow users to switch between different modes depending on their needs. This feature makes them versatile enough to use in various scenarios without sacrificing accuracy or performance.
